It was a classroom game called "7-Up". Seven kid went to the front of the room, everyone else put their heads down and thumbs up. Those who were 'it" tiptoed around and gently put someone's thumb down. Once they were all back up front, everyone would put their heads back up and those who had been tapped would stand up and take turns trying to guess who had tapped them. If you guessed correctly, you took their place up front.
It was just one of those games we'd play with the kids when we were ready a little too early for lunch/music/gym/whatever - when there was not enough time to start the next subject, but it was too early to leave and have them waiting noisily in the hall.
